MUSREDB2.gif (5850 bytes) 1st Grade General Music

This nine weeks the students in first grade have been:

1. Recognizing the "singing voice" as their instrument.

2. Recognizing the difference between "singing voice," and "talking" or "speaking" voice

3. Speaking together in rhyme.

4. Clapping, tapping, and playing instruments with a steady beat.

5. Learning to sing, handsign and play all of the melodic pitch syllables. (do, re,mi, fa, so, la, ti, do)

6. Practice following the teacher and/or other student leaders in actions.

7. Reading music icons (or pictures) which represent notes and written music.

8. Learning to start, stop, and stay together when singing and performing.

9. Listening to determine if sounds are "the same" or "different" and matching the melodic pitch of the teacher.

Our listening activity this month was: Variations on "Ah vous dirai-je Maman" (or "Twinkle, Twinkle Little Star") written by Wolfgang Amadeus Mozart.
